Is He Dr. Dreamdate?

Congratulations, Andie Reynolds! You know why the local kids call your neighbor Dr. Frankenstein. He never emerges from his big old house and spends most of his time concocting explosive experiments. When you went to visit, you half expected to be greeted by a mad scientist. Instead, you found yourself gazing at a pint-size version of the good doctor himself.

And what a good-looking doctor, too! It's hard to resist Eli Masters and his adorable little boy, but resist you must. They will only lead to heart trouble--the kind no medicine can cure....

About the author

Leanne Banks

520 books289 followers
Leanne Banks was born on 14 May 1959 in Roanoke, Virginia, USA. She holds a Bachelors degree in Psychology, which she claims she can only use on fictional characters. When her first book was published in 1991, she used the money from her advance to take her family to Disney World.

Leanne is known for telling a story with strong emotion, characters with whom everyone can relate, a kick of hot sensuality, and a feel-good ending that lingers. She believes in creating stories for her readers that will allow them to escape into a place filled fun, emotion and sensuality. She believes that she has the best readers in the world because they understand that love is the greatest miracle of all.

Leanne is the recipient of Romantic Times Magazine's career-achievement awards in Series Sensuality and Love and Laughter, and her books have been recognized by the Award of Excellence Contest, the Romance Writers of America RITA Award contest and the National Readers' Choice Awards. She is grateful for awards and reviews and was particularly moved by a letter from a reader remarking that Leanne's book got her through a chemotherapy session. The reader's letter inspired a favorite turn of phrase: Never underestimate the power of a romance novel.

Leanne lives in her native Virginia with her husband, two teenage children and a Pomeranian. She also has a little condo in South Carolina where she writes in the off-season. She loves music, chocolate, quotes, and new adventures.

I have to say I enjoyed the sequel of this book more than this. The hero is a scientist who has been granted the full custody of his son after his ex-wife's death and he is trying to be the best father but science comes easy to him than reaching a grieving five year old. Their neighbour is the heroine, a nurse who is a nurturer, that is how she defines herself since she is always taking care of people and kids. She raised her three siblings and then it turned out her ex-fiancée used her skill with kids to cheat on her by having his daughter stay with her, so the last thing she needs is to be attracted to another man especially one who is a single father. Since the heroine's heartbreak was relatively fresh I felt she blew a bit hot and cold, friendly one moment and then second guessing things a moment later which annoyed me. She was quite ashamed of how she had been duped so didn't tell the hero who was falling quite fast for her. I did feel for most of the book that the hero was more invested in her but overall a nice book.
